CSS結(jié)尾的爬蟲使用指南
在網(wǎng)頁開發(fā)中,CSS(級聯(lián)樣式表)是一種用于描述HTML文檔樣式的語言,而當(dāng)我們在談?wù)摗癈SS結(jié)尾的爬蟲”時,我們實際上指的是一種特殊的網(wǎng)絡(luò)爬蟲,它能夠處理和分析以CSS結(jié)尾的網(wǎng)頁內(nèi)容,這種爬蟲在獲取和處理網(wǎng)頁信息時,能夠更準(zhǔn)確地識別和提取所需的內(nèi)容。
要使用CSS結(jié)尾的爬蟲,首先需要了解其基本構(gòu)成和原理,這種爬蟲通常包括一個解析器,用于解析網(wǎng)頁內(nèi)容,以及一個選擇器,用于根據(jù)CSS選擇器定位并提取所需信息,還需要一些輔助模塊,如HTTP請求模塊和DOM處理模塊,以完成整個爬取過程。
在編寫CSS結(jié)尾的爬蟲時,我們需要遵循一定的步驟和注意事項,需要確定目標(biāo)網(wǎng)站的結(jié)構(gòu)和特點,以便選擇合適的CSS選擇器和解析器,需要處理網(wǎng)頁中的動態(tài)內(nèi)容和交互元素,以確保能夠獲取到完整和準(zhǔn)確的信息,還需要注意遵守網(wǎng)站的使用協(xié)議和法律法規(guī),以避免任何潛在的法律風(fēng)險。
除了基本的構(gòu)成和原理外,CSS結(jié)尾的爬蟲還有一些優(yōu)化和擴展的方法,我們可以利用一些第三方庫或工具來提高爬取效率和準(zhǔn)確性,還可以結(jié)合其他技術(shù)(如JavaScript渲染引擎)來模擬瀏覽器行為,從而獲取更加真實和全面的網(wǎng)頁內(nèi)容。
CSS結(jié)尾的爬蟲是一種強大的工具,能夠幫助我們更加高效地獲取和處理網(wǎng)頁信息,在使用過程中,我們需要了解其基本原理和注意事項,并根據(jù)實際需求進行一定的優(yōu)化和擴展。